How the Shahab Khodro Bus Air Conditioner Works

Shahab Khodro bus air conditioner is crucial to travel comfort and passenger health. It consists of multiple components, such as a compressor and condenser, each performing a different function. Its operating principle is based on a cooling or heating cycle and can be categorized by drive mode and function. Daily inspections and regular maintenance are essential to maintaining the proper function of the air conditioning system. This includes checking the control panel, air flow and temperature before departure, and regularly cleaning components such as the condenser and evaporator.

The Importance of the Shahab Khodro Bus Air Conditioner
When we embark on a tour bus journey, we often don't pay much attention to the vehicle's Bus Air Conditioner, but it actually plays a crucial role. First, from the perspective of passenger comfort, whether in the scorching summer or the cold winter, appropriate temperature, humidity, and air circulation have a significant impact on the passenger experience. In the summer, tour buses may travel on hot roads. Without an effective air conditioning system, the interior can become a stuffy "steamer," making passengers prone to heatstroke and irritability. In winter, frigid air can make the interior of a bus uncomfortably cold. The air conditioning system provides warm airflow, protecting passengers from the harsh cold.

Furthermore, from a health perspective, a good air conditioning system helps regulate the humidity inside the bus, preventing the growth of bacteria, mold, and other microorganisms caused by excessive humidity, and preventing dry skin and respiratory irritation caused by low humidity. Furthermore, it continuously refreshes the air inside the bus, removing pollutants such as carbon dioxide and odors, ensuring passengers breathe fresh, clean air. This is especially critical for long-distance travelers.

Shahab Khodro Bus Air Conditioner Working Principle is based on a refrigeration cycle and a heating cycle (if heating is available).
For example, in the refrigeration cycle, the compressor begins operating, compressing the low-temperature, low-pressure gas refrigerant from the evaporator into a high-temperature, high-pressure gas refrigerant.
The high-temperature, high-pressure gas refrigerant then flows into the condenser, where it exchanges heat with the outside air through the condenser's fins, releasing heat and transforming into a high-temperature, high-pressure liquid refrigerant. Next, the high-temperature, high-pressure liquid refrigerant passes through the expansion valve, throttling and reducing its pressure before becoming a low-temperature, low-pressure liquid refrigerant that enters the evaporator.
In the evaporator, the liquid refrigerant absorbs heat from the surrounding air and rapidly evaporates, turning into a low-temperature, low-pressure gaseous refrigerant. The ambient air temperature then drops, allowing the fan to blow cool air into the vehicle cabin, achieving cooling. The gaseous refrigerant is then drawn into the compressor to begin the next cycle.

For the heating cycle (as in some heating and cooling air conditioning systems), the operating principle is slightly different. Heat is typically generated by the engine coolant or a dedicated heating device, and then the heated air is blown into the vehicle cabin through the air ducts of the air conditioning system. Some newer tour bus air conditioning systems may also utilize heat pump technology for heating, which more efficiently utilizes electricity or other energy sources for heating.
